Joe Mess Pro rounds 2 coverage from the 2018 PDG A Disc Golf World Championships in Smuggler's Notch, Vermont, is on display here. Big Sexy commentary team Nate Sexton and Jeremy Coleman guide viewers through a thrilling round at Bruce's Ridge, one of two courses featured. The action unfolds amidst technical holes with hills, out-of-bounds areas, and a wooded landscape that demands precision putting and mid-range shots. Young Nico Locastro takes the lead card position, showcasing his skills as a 23-year-old player who has been on the podium before in 2015. His calculated strategy and accuracy are put to the test as he navigates through the challenging course with Nate Sexton's expert commentary providing insight into his thought process and shot selection.
